Transaction 8eb3e018dc563237e98eb5386f16df007f3f20411bbd98ab42bdc1f5a77c73bd

12 Input
1 Outputs
  • 8eb3e018dc563237e98eb5386f16df007f3f20411bbd98ab42bdc1f5a77c73bd:0
  • value  8230815
    address  3JCYdhD5J9Hdt26X5etrRzUCeJoiYNZehg